    "I'm Already There" is a song by American country music band Lonestar, written by lead singer Richie McDonald along with Gary Baker and Frank J. Myers. It was released on April 16, 2001 as the lead-off single to their fourth studio album of the same name .

    I'm Already There, Lonestar's fourth album, was released in 2001. The same year, the band won the Country Music Association's award for Vocal Group of the Year. [8] Serving as the lead single was the album's title track, which McDonald wrote with Gary Baker and Frank J. Myers. [28] The song was inspired by McDonald's son, Rhett. [29]

    I'm Already There is the fourth studio album by American country music band Lonestar. Released in 2001 on BNA Records (see 2001 in country music ), the album was certified platinum by the RIAA for sales of one million copies.

    "I'm Already Taken" is the debut single by American country music artist Steve Wariner, released in April 1978. It peaked at number 63 on the U.S. Billboard country singles chart. [ 1 ] In 1999, Wariner re-recorded the song for his album Two Teardrops .

    "I'm from the Country" is a song written by Marty Brown, Stan Webb and Richard Young, who is the rhythm guitarist for the band The Kentucky Headhunters, and recorded by the American country music artist Tracy Byrd. It was released in February 1998 as the first single and title track from his album I'm from the Country.
